Bestandsconversie in .NET onder de knie krijgen: VSDX-bestanden naar DOCX converteren met GroupDocs.Conversion
Invoering
Bent u het zat om handmatig Microsoft Visio-diagrammen (.vsdx) naar Word-documenten (.docx) te converteren? Of u nu een ontwikkelaar bent die projectdocumentatie beheert of een kantoormedewerker die processen wil stroomlijnen, efficiënte bestandsconversie kan tijd besparen en fouten verminderen. Met de GroupDocs.Conversion-bibliotheek voor .NET automatiseert u deze taak naadloos.
In deze tutorial laten we zien hoe u de krachtige GroupDocs.Conversion-bibliotheek in uw .NET-applicaties kunt gebruiken om VSDX-bestanden te laden en te converteren naar DOCX-formaat. Door de tutorial te volgen, krijgt u een beter begrip van bestandsconversieprocessen in .NET-omgevingen.
Wat je leert:
- Hoe u GroupDocs.Conversion voor .NET instelt en initialiseert.
- Laad VSDX-bestanden met behulp van de bibliotheek.
- Converteer deze bestanden naar Word-documenten in DOCX-formaat.
- Ontdek praktische toepassingen voor deze functie.
- Implementeer best practices voor het optimaliseren van prestaties.
Laten we ervoor zorgen dat u alles hebt wat u nodig hebt om aan de slag te gaan met GroupDocs.Conversion voor .NET.
Vereisten
Voordat u aan de slag gaat met de code, moet u ervoor zorgen dat uw ontwikkelomgeving is voorbereid:
- Bibliotheken en afhankelijkheden:
- Installeer GroupDocs.Conversion versie 25.3.0.
- Vereisten voor omgevingsinstelling:
- Zorg ervoor dat u over een .NET-ontwikkelingsinstallatie beschikt (bijvoorbeeld Visual Studio).
- Kennisvereisten:
- Basiskennis van C#-programmering en bestandsbeheer in .NET.
GroupDocs.Conversion instellen voor .NET
Om GroupDocs.Conversion te gaan gebruiken, integreert u de bibliotheek in uw project via NuGet of .NET CLI:
NuGet-pakketbeheerconsole:
Install-Package GroupDocs.Conversion -Version 25.3.0
.NET CLI:
dotnet add package GroupDocs.Conversion --version 25.3.0
Een licentie verkrijgen
GroupDocs biedt verschillende licentieopties:
- Gratis proefperiode: Download de bibliotheek om de functies ervan te testen.
- Tijdelijke licentie: Vraag een tijdelijke licentie aan voor evaluatiedoeleinden.
- Aankoop: Koop een volledige licentie voor commercieel gebruik.
Met slechts een paar regels code kunt u GroupDocs.Conversion in uw applicatie initialiseren en instellen:
using System;
using GroupDocs.Conversion;
namespace YourNamespace
{
class Program
{
static void Main(string[] args)
{
// Initialiseer het Converter-exemplaar met uw bestandspad
string documentPath = "YOUR_DOCUMENT_DIRECTORY/sample.vsdx";
using (var converter = new Converter(documentPath))
{
// Het bestand is nu geladen en klaar voor conversie.
}
}
}
}
Met deze configuratie bent u klaar om te ontdekken hoe GroupDocs.Conversion uw workflow kan transformeren.
Implementatiegids
Functie 1: Een VSDX-bestand laden
Overzicht: Het laden van bestanden is de eerste stap in elk conversieproces. We beginnen met het laden van een Microsoft Visio-bestand via GroupDocs.Conversion.
Stap 1: Converter initialiseren
- Waarom: Hiermee wordt een instantie geïnitialiseerd om bestandsbewerkingen af te handelen.
string documentPath = "YOUR_DOCUMENT_DIRECTORY/sample.vsdx";
using (var converter = new Converter(documentPath))
{
// Het bestand is nu geladen en klaar voor conversie.
}
Functie 2: VSDX naar DOCX-formaat converteren
Overzicht: Als u uw bestand van VSDX naar DOCX-formaat wilt converteren, moet u specifieke conversieopties instellen en de conversie uitvoeren.
Stap 1: Conversieopties instellen
- Waarom: Geef aan hoe het uitvoerdocument moet worden weergegeven.
using GroupDocs.Conversion.Options.Convert;
var convertOptions = new WordProcessingConvertOptions();
Stap 2: Voer de conversie uit
- Waarom: Voer het conversieproces uit en sla het resultaat op in DOCX-formaat.
string outputFile = Path.Combine("YOUR_OUTPUT_DIRECTORY", "vsdx-converted-to.docx");
converter.Convert(outputFile, convertOptions);
Tips voor probleemoplossing
- Zorg ervoor dat de bestandspaden correct zijn om te voorkomen
FileNotFoundException
. - Controleer de compatibiliteit van de GroupDocs.Conversion-versie met uw .NET-framework.
Praktische toepassingen
- Documentbeheersystemen: Automatische conversie van ontwerpbestanden naar bewerkbare Word-documenten.
- Projectdocumentatie: Converteer Visio-diagrammen voor opname in projectrapporten.
- Onderwijsmaterialen: Maak lesmateriaal door visuele hulpmiddelen om te zetten in tekstformaten.
Door GroupDocs.Conversion te integreren met andere .NET-frameworks kunt u de functionaliteit verbeteren. U kunt bijvoorbeeld bestandsopslagservices toevoegen of integreren met API’s voor documentbeheer.
Prestatieoverwegingen
- Optimaliseer het gebruik van hulpbronnen: Beperk het aantal bestanden dat tegelijkertijd kan worden verwerkt.
- Geheugenbeheer: Gooi voorwerpen op de juiste manier weg met behulp van
using
uitspraken om middelen vrij te maken. - Aanbevolen werkwijzen voor prestaties: Test conversies eerst op kleine batches en controleer de applicatieprestaties.
Conclusie
U beheerst nu hoe u VSDX-bestanden kunt laden en converteren naar DOCX-formaat met GroupDocs.Conversion voor .NET. Dit verbetert niet alleen de productiviteit, maar integreert ook naadloos met uw bestaande .NET-applicaties.
Volgende stappen
Ontdek de extra functies van GroupDocs.Conversion, zoals het converteren naar andere bestandsindelingen of het integreren van conversiemogelijkheden in grotere systemen.
Oproep tot actie: Probeer deze conversies eens uit in uw volgende project en ervaar zelf de efficiëntieverbeteringen!
FAQ-sectie
- Wat zijn enkele veelvoorkomende toepassingsgevallen voor het converteren van VSDX naar DOCX?
- Automatiseer documentworkflows en verbeter de hulpmiddelen voor samenwerking.
- Hoe ga ik om met grote bestanden tijdens de conversie?
- Verdeel ze in kleinere delen of vergroot tijdelijk de systeembronnen.
- Kan GroupDocs.Conversion gebruikt worden in cloudomgevingen?
- Ja, integratie met cloudgebaseerde opslagoplossingen wordt ondersteund.
- Is er een limiet aan de bestandsgrootte die geconverteerd kan worden?
- De limiet is afhankelijk van het beschikbare geheugen en de verwerkingskracht in uw omgeving.
- Hoe los ik conversiefouten op?
- Controleer de documentatie op foutcodes en zorg ervoor dat de invoerbestanden toegankelijk en correct zijn opgemaakt.
Bronnen
- Documentatie
- API-referentie
- Download
- Licentie kopen
- Gratis proefperiode
- Tijdelijke licentie
- Ondersteuningsforum
Door deze handleiding te volgen, beschikt u over de kennis om GroupDocs.Conversion voor .NET effectief te gebruiken. Veel plezier met coderen!